Valezim is a town and municipality in Portugal .

history

There was a Castro culture settlement here, but very little remains of it. Possibly lasted around 150 BC. Chr. Viriathus here occasionally, in the fight of the Lusitans against the advancing Romans . They probably called the place Vellcinus or Vallecinus (about "small valley"), from which the current name developed.

The present place was only created during the medieval Reconquista . Valezim received its first town charter in 1201, which was confirmed and renewed in 1514 by King D. Manuel I. He made Valezim at the same time a small administrative town ( Vila ) and the seat of a district. In the course of the administrative reforms after the Liberal Revolution of 1822 and the Miguelistenkrieg that followed in 1834 , the Valezim district was dissolved in 1836 and Loriga was incorporated . Since its dissolution in 1855, Valezim belongs to Seia.

A textile industry has been developing here since the beginning of the 19th century, based on local wool production. In the second half of the 19th century, however, it steadily lost its importance as technologically advanced companies emerged in other parts of the region.

administration

Valezim is a parish ( freguesia ) in the district ( concelho ) of Seia , Guarda district . It has an area of ​​12.1 km² and 310 inhabitants (as of June 30, 2011).
